As a continuation of the author's previous work, this paper deals with matrix representations of the extremal operator \(S^+|\text{Ker } P(S^+)\). The motivation is in the convergence theory of the iteration process \(y_{s + 1} = Ay_s + b\). Based on some natural identities involving Möbius functions of the shift operator on the Hardy space \(H^2\), an approach is proposed. The advantage of this new approach lies in the fact that it is simple and reduces the amount of computations. In fact, the operator identities are not without interest in their own right: they are valid for an isometry in an arbitrary Hilbert space.
